Efficient Irrigation with Sprinkler Systems Smart Watering Techniques
Sprinkler systems offer a efficient method for irrigating lawns and gardens. By distributing water evenly across large plots, these systems help to maximize plant growth while conserving water waste. With various sprinkler types available, homeowners can select the ideal system for their particular requirements .
Properly designed and installed sprinkler systems result in healthier plants and a vibrant landscape. They also make easier the irrigation process, freeing up your time for other tasks. Moreover, sprinkler systems can be automated for precise watering schedules. This control helps to minimize environmental impact .
To ensure best performance and effectiveness , sprinkler systems require regular maintenance. This includes inspecting nozzles for clogs, adjusting watering schedules based on climatic factors, and addressing any repairs promptly.

Sustain Your Irrigation Sprinklers in Tip-Top Shape
To ensure the longevity of your irrigation sprinklers, regular maintenance is key. Begin by examining your sprinkler system at least once a month for any clues of damage or leaks. Completely scrub the sprinkler heads with a tool to eliminate debris and mineral buildup. Think about using a soft cleaning solution if necessary. Confirm more info that all sprinkler heads are positioned correctly to deliver water evenly across your lawn.
- Inspect the pressure valve frequently to ensure optimal water pressure.
- Empty your sprinkler system in the fall to prevent freeze damage during winter months.
- Refer a professional irrigation specialist for any repairs or maintenance tasks you are afraid to manage yourself.
Modern Innovations in Irrigation Sprinkler Technology
The realm of irrigation has undergone a remarkable transformation with the advent of state-of-the-art sprinkler technology. These cutting-edge systems harness a range of sensors to monitor soil moisture, weather patterns, and plant needs. This automated approach promotes optimal water consumption, leading to enhanced crop yields while minimizing waste.
Furthermore, modern sprinklers tend to incorporate features such as adjustable spray patterns, pressure regulation, and even remote control. This degree of customization enables farmers to accurately target their irrigation efforts, optimizing water allocation.
- For example, drip irrigation systems provide water directly to the base of plants, minimizing evaporation and encouraging healthy growth.
- Smart sprinklers can interpret weather predictions to modify watering schedules, responding to real-time situations.
Through the continuous evolution of sprinkler technology, agriculture is poised to become even more eco-friendly, ensuring a stable food supply for a growing population.
